It is a system in which a 3rd celebration supplier delivers these app growth tools by way of a internet connection, with the mandatory hardware and software supporting it hosted off-site. The dangers of PaaS could be minimized by fully assessing the prices of utilizing PaaS instruments for application improvement and deployment. Enterprises can sometimes cut back prices via careful characteristic selection, and all cloud suppliers offer tools to estimate costs.
But with any system/architecture, PaaS, too, has its share of advantages as well as disadvantages. A relatively quick time within the industry or significant knowledge breaches and authorized issues can be big pink flags. Ensure you’ll have the ability to reach them using varied channels corresponding to phone, email, live chat, or social media. Besides that, the perfect PaaS supplier should have moral pointers and clear confidentiality insurance policies to make sure information privacy.
The project editor is where you’ll outline your app’s data model and relationships. Back4App is constructed on top of AWS, so you possibly can make sure that your app will at all times be up and running. AWS’s dependable servers and advanced applied sciences make sure that your app will all the time be out there, even throughout peak times. This means companies should belief the PaaS supplier to properly secure their surroundings and ensure that their data is safe from malicious actors. This could be a major disadvantage for startups or small businesses that don’t have lots of capital to put cash into PaaS options. For instance, if an organization needs to create an app for each Android and iOS, it can easily accomplish that with a PaaS resolution, permitting them to reach a wider audience.
What Are The Disadvantages Of Paas?
While IaaS provides just the pay-as-you-go infrastructure for a company, PaaS steps it up by additionally offering a big selection of tools wanted to create applications. Meanwhile, SaaS is ready-to-use software program that’s available by way of a third party over the internet. The top cloud service suppliers are beginning to offer AI-platform-as-a-service (AIPaaS), a platform for distributed synthetic intelligence (AI) applications.
Exploring PaaS advantages and disadvantages, we will start with the unhealthy information first. This signifies that when you ever have an issue with your app, Back4App might be there that will assist you out shortly and effectively. Back4App also provides tutorials and other resources that will help you get probably the most out of their Platform. All information is encrypted in transit and at relaxation, so that you can be assured that your app and its customers are safe.
This means that companies don’t have to hire additional personnel for duties similar to server maintenance, security updates, software monitoring, and so on, which may save them a lot of money in the lengthy term. PaaS solutions are often offered on a pay-as-you-go foundation, which implies companies only need to pay for the resources they use. Once an software has been developed and tested, it might be deployed to production with only a few clicks utilizing most PaaS options. Businesses can also arrange Continuous Delivery/Deployment (CD/CD) pipelines to automatically push new code adjustments to manufacturing as quickly as they’re approved.
Paas: Platform As A Service
Now, it’s time to shed some gentle on the advantages and downsides of PaaS, that can help you make the very best choice. Platform as a service (PaaS) computing expertise has been bringing in several advantages to firms. From elevated productiveness, reduced prices, and scalability to several other enhancements. Besides that, OpenShift has multiple safeguards constructed into the development surroundings, which step in if someone tries to perform sudden actions like working containers with incorrect permissions. OpenShift provides enterprise-grade Linux working system, networking, container runtime, registry, monitoring, and authentication and authorization options. It also has intensive API support to fit different merchandise in your workflow without any worries.
If your enterprise belongs to this category of companies, you need to choose the platform even more scrupulously. A firm can access digital variations of its physical infrastructure, similar to knowledge centres, servers, storage, and networking instruments, using PaaS technology. In addition, a center layer of software that offers instruments for developing apps is also accessible.
Cost Saving
What’s happened as an alternative is that the cloud has become more of a common entrance end to legacy data center functions. PaaS is a cloud computing service provider that advantages builders and organizations with an application-development platform by way of virtualization. Infrastructure as a service is utilized by companies that don’t wish to preserve their very own on-premises information centers. The IaaS cloud vendor hosts the infrastructure parts that usually exist in an on-premises data heart, together with servers, storage and networking hardware, in addition to the hypervisor or virtualization layer. Users don’t should obtain and set up SaaS purposes on native units, however sometimes they might need plugins.
Try to lay out all PaaS necessities for current and future functions, and then use that list to search out software program sources, beginning with software program suppliers that may fulfill the most important variety of PaaS wants. Companies are utilizing PaaS as they develop their very own SaaS, as they migrate to the cloud and while creating cross-platform purposes that can be used on any gadget. Popular PaaS providers embody AWS Elastic Beanstalk, Microsoft Azure App Services, Google App Engine, IBM Cloud and Red Hat OpenShift. PaaS can be extremely cost-effective compared to conventional data centers or cloud hosting suppliers when deployed correctly. In a means, PaaS acts like a bunch with a lot of further goodies coming with the package!
This ensures that only authorized users have access to your app’s information and sources. Furthermore, most PaaS providers offer pay-as-you-go pricing models, which means companies solely have to pay for the assets they use. Not solely will this assist them get financial savings, however it’ll also make sure that they don’t should pay for unused sources disadvantages of paas. There are many various varieties of cloud computing companies out there to companies at present. Many PaaS companies, each hosted and self-hosted, offer unlimited and hourly access. Typically, basic PaaS companies cost from a number of dollars to a number of thousands per thirty days, depending on what you want.
Google App Engine
It’s additionally a super choice for businesses that want a cost-effective method to scale their apps as wanted. And with its low-code method, Back4app can be utilized by anyone—even these without any coding experience. Back4App is a good solution for developers who want a fast, dependable, and safe back-end platform to shortly create trendy apps.
Since builders have access to quite a few automated tools and technological improvements, they’ll considerably speed up the creation of apps. Hence, the app improvement lifecycle is reduced, in comparability with the standard one, and more new products can enter the market faster. PaaS know-how offers a company digital infrastructure, similar to data centers, servers, storage and network tools, plus an intermediate layer of software program, which incorporates instruments for building apps. Of course, a person interface can additionally be part of the package to provide usability.
- You can develop new applications without worrying about the trouble of sustaining the equipment.
- This makes PaaS an attractive proposition for small businesses and startups that don’t want to make huge upfront investments in infrastructure.
- Leading cloud service providers are starting to offer AI-platform-as-a-service (AIPaaS), which is a platform for delivering artificial intelligence (AI) functions.
- Many PaaS providers, each hosted and self-hosted, provide limitless and hourly access.
- Now, as you’ve got a tough concept of cloud service fashions, let’s move on to their detailed examination.
- Based on this statistic and our personal experience, we’ve compiled a list of five high Platform as a Service advantages.
Finally, PaaS options can sometimes be tough to combine with current methods. This is because PaaS platforms typically use proprietary applied sciences and require companies to rewrite their applications to be able to work with them. PaaS solutions are maintained and managed by the seller, which suggests businesses don’t have to worry about maintaining with the newest software updates or security patches. PaaS solutions provide a spread of id administration features that make it simple to regulate access to functions.
This platform provides a range of app growth providers along with databases, computation, reminiscence, and storage. Today, Heroku is a half of the broader Salesforce Platform of developer instruments, supporting a variety of languages and thousands of developers who run functions on it. In apply, utilizing Heroku involves constructing on a typical runtime deployed in virtualized Linux containers—or dynos, as Heroku calls them—spread throughout a dyno grid of AWS servers. With a PaaS, developers have restricted scope to vary their improvement environment, which might result in some team members feeling hemmed in. The incapability to make modifications to the surroundings or get function requests deployed by the service supplier can result in corporations outgrowing their PaaS and building their very own inner developer platform. The underlying infrastructure that applications finally run on is absolutely managed by the service provider.
Read on to be taught precisely what PaaS is, the advantages it offers an organization, the challenges it might present along with common examples and emerging tech. By launching pre-configured environments, customers can concentrate on growth, prototyping, and creating new products without having to worry about computing assets. One of the principle advantages of cloud computing is the power to scale assets on demand. Maintaining a business’ capacity to meet the changing needs of its purchasers is crucial. There are a lot of PaaS offerings for businesses that require substantial application growth all through their operations.
Businesses can use these options to create and handle consumer accounts, in addition to assign roles and permissions. This kind of service allows businesses to outsource the internet hosting and management of their applications and information. While there are numerous benefits to using a PaaS, there are also some drawbacks that you should be aware of before making a choice. The key to success with this method is minimizing the number of software sources required to create the personal PaaS.
enterprise. Once a PaaS product is deployed, IT pros are tasked with ensuring everyone is on prime of things and understands the brand new process. Finally, maintaining a detailed relationship along with your cloud supplier is vital for ongoing support https://www.globalcloudteam.com/, collaboration and communication. It seems like a win-win, however top talent with cloud computing talent units and experience is still hard to seek out. Learning how to analyze, evaluate and design cloud computing
What Are The Advantages And Drawbacks Of Paas?